征服AI之巅:10步解锁自然语言处理工程师之路

引言:

人工智能的浪潮席卷全球,而自然语言处理 (NLP) 作为其核心领域之一,正吸引着越来越多的目光。试想,让机器理解并生成人类语言,这将会是怎样一番景象? 如果你对这个充满挑战和机遇的领域充满憧憬,渴望成为一名优秀的自然语言处理工程师,那么就跟随我们的脚步,一起踏上这段激动人心的学习之旅吧!

第一步:夯实基础,构建知识大厦

万丈高楼平地起,成为一名优秀的自然语言处理工程师,首先要打下坚实的基础。这意味着你需要学习计算机科学的基础知识,包括数据结构、算法和编程语言 (如 Python)。 同时,概率论、统计学和线性代数等数学基础也是不可或缺的基石。

第二步:掌握核心概念,洞悉NLP奥秘

了解自然语言处理的核心概念是成为一名优秀工程师的关键。你需要学习词法分析、句法分析、语义分析和语言生成等基本概念,这些知识将帮助你理解和解决自然语言处理中的各种挑战。

第三步:熟练运用工具和库,事半功倍

自然语言处理领域拥有众多强大的工具和库,例如 NLTK、spaCy 和 Stanford NLP。学习和掌握这些工具和库可以帮助你更高效地处理和分析自然语言数据,事半功倍。

第四步:拥抱机器学习和深度学习,赋予机器语言智慧

机器学习和深度学习技术在自然语言处理中扮演着至关重要的角色。学习机器学习算法和深度学习框架 (如 TensorFlow 和 PyTorch) 可以帮助你构建和训练强大的自然语言处理模型,赋予机器理解和生成人类语言的智慧。

第五步:阅读论文,汲取前沿知识

阅读和实践相关领域的论文和项目是成为一名优秀自然语言处理工程师的重要步骤。通过阅读最新的研究成果,你可以深入了解自然语言处理的前沿技术和应用,开拓视野。

第六步:参与竞赛,挑战自我极限

参加自然语言处理领域的竞赛和挑战是提升技能的绝佳机会。在实战中检验和提升自己的能力,与其他优秀工程师同台竞技,你将获得宝贵的经验和成长。

第七步:实践项目,积累实战经验

实践是检验真理的唯一标准。尝试解决实际的自然语言处理问题,并构建自己的模型,可以帮助你深入理解和应用所学知识,积累宝贵的实战经验。

第八步:与专家交流,碰撞思维火花

与自然语言处理领域的专业人士交流和合作是提升自我的关键步骤。参加相关的学术会议和研讨会,加入自然语言处理社区,与其他专业人士分享和讨论,你将获得新的启发,碰撞出思维的火花。

第九步:持续学习,紧跟时代步伐

自然语言处理领域的技术和应用日新月异,作为一名优秀工程师,持续学习和跟进最新进展是必不可少的。订阅相关的学术期刊和博客,参加培训和研讨会,保持对自然语言处理领域的关注,才能不被时代所淘汰。

第十步:贡献社区,推动行业发展

成为自然语言处理领域的专家和领导者,最终目标是为社区做出贡献。通过发表论文、开源项目、指导学生和分享经验,你可以帮助推动自然语言处理领域的发展,与其他人共同推动这个令人兴奋的领域的进步。

结语:

成为一名自然语言处理工程师需要你付出努力和汗水,但同时也会带给你巨大的成就感和满足感。 这十个步骤将为你指明方向,帮助你成为一名优秀的自然语言处理工程师,在人工智能的浪潮中乘风破浪,创造属于自己的辉煌!

征服AI之巅:10步解锁自然语言处理工程师之路

原文地址: https://www.cveoy.top/t/topic/eza4 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录